WebMedicare may cover ambulance transportation in some cases when you’re not facing a medical emergency. To receive this coverage, your doctor needs to write an order stating that an ambulance is medically necessary because other ways to get you to an appointment could endanger your health. WebOct 1, 2024 · In a nonemergency situation, Medicare may still cover an ambulance ride to a hospital or health facility if your doctor writes an order saying that your medical condition makes it necessary. In addition, if you have ESRD, Medicare might cover ambulance transportation to or from a dialysis center.
